What does a pipeline integrity engineer do?

The responsibilities of a pipeline integrity engineer revolve around ensuring that pipeline operations meet standards and requirements for safety, quality, and legality. As a pipeline integrity engineer, your duties may include performing inspections for oil, gas, or other liquid pipelines, creating technical reports, and conducting evaluations of pipeline processes in real-world conditions. Your employer expects you to have the necessary skills and knowledge for executing cost-effective inspections and tests. You must perform your job duties without adversely affecting pipeline operations.

What does a pipeline integrity engineer do?

A Pipeline Integrity Engineer is responsible for ensuring the safety, reliability, and efficiency of pipelines that transport oil, gas, or other materials. Their main tasks include monitoring pipeline conditions, assessing risks, and implementing maintenance or repair strategies to prevent leaks, corrosion, or failures. They also analyze data from inspections, use specialized software and tools, and comply with industry regulations and safety standards. By doing so, Pipeline Integrity Engineers help protect the environment, public safety, and company assets.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a pipeline integrity eng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Pipeline Integrity Engineer, you need a solid background in engineering (typically mechanical, civil, or materials), knowledge of pipeline design and corrosion principles, and a relevant engineering degree. Familiarity with integrity management software, inspection tools (like ultrasonic testing), and certifications such as API 1169 or NACE CP are commonly required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help professionals excel in risk assessment and cross-functional collaboration. These competencies are crucial for ensuring the safety, reliability, and regulatory compliance of pipeline systems.

How does a pipeline integrity engineer typically collaborate with other departments to ensure pipeline safety and compliance?

Pipeline Integrity Engineers work closely with various departments such as operations, maintenance, and regulatory compliance teams to ensure the safety and reliability of pipeline systems. They often coordinate inspections, share data on pipeline conditions, and develop mitigation strategies in partnership with field technicians and risk assessment specialists. Regular communication and teamwork are essential, as the engineer must align integrity management plans with both technical standards and regulatory requirements. This cross-functional collaboration helps in proactively identifying issues and implementing solutions that maintain compliance and operational excellence.

What is the difference between Pipeline Integrity Engineer vs Pipeline Maintenance Technician?

AspectPipeline Integrity EngineerPipeline Maintenance Technician
CredentialsBachelor's degree in engineering or related field, certifications like API 1169High school diploma or technical training, certifications like API 653 or 570
Work EnvironmentOffice-based with site visits, focus on analysis and planningFieldwork, on-site inspections, repairs and maintenance
Industry UsageDesign, assessment, and integrity management of pipelinesRoutine maintenance, repairs, and inspections of pipelines

The Pipeline Integrity Engineer focuses on assessing and ensuring the safety and reliability of pipelines through analysis and planning, often working in an office environment. In contrast, the Pipeline Maintenance Technician handles hands-on repairs and inspections in the field. Both roles are essential in pipeline operations but differ in responsibilities, credentials, and work settings.
